Home
last modified time | relevance | path

Searched refs:StrTable (Results 1 – 10 of 10) sorted by relevance

/external/llvm-project/llvm/tools/llvm-objcopy/MachO/
DMachOReader.cpp191 SymbolEntry constructSymbolEntry(StringRef StrTable, const nlist_t &nlist) { in constructSymbolEntry() argument
192 assert(nlist.n_strx < StrTable.size() && in constructSymbolEntry()
195 SE.Name = StringRef(StrTable.data() + nlist.n_strx).str(); in constructSymbolEntry()
204 StringRef StrTable = MachOObj.getStringTableData(); in readSymbolTable() local
208 ? constructSymbolEntry(StrTable, MachOObj.getSymbol64TableEntry( in readSymbolTable()
210 : constructSymbolEntry(StrTable, MachOObj.getSymbolTableEntry( in readSymbolTable()
DObject.h304 StringTable StrTable; member
DMachOWriter.cpp303 uint8_t *StrTable = (uint8_t *)B.getBufferStart() + SymTabCommand.stroff; in writeStringTable() local
304 LayoutBuilder.getStringTableBuilder().write(StrTable); in writeStringTable()
/external/rust/crates/grpcio-sys/grpc/third_party/upb/tests/
Dtest_table.cc121 class StrTable { class
123 StrTable(upb_ctype_t value_type) { upb_strtable_init(&table_, value_type); } in StrTable() function in upb::StrTable
124 ~StrTable() { upb_strtable_uninit(&table_); } in ~StrTable()
153 explicit iterator(StrTable* table) { in iterator()
157 static iterator end(StrTable* table) { in end()
229 iter.iter_ = StrTable::iterator::end(&table->table_); in end()
252 StrTable::iterator iter_;
258 StrTable table_;
/external/llvm/tools/llvm-readobj/
DELFDumper.cpp232 std::string getFullSymbolName(const Elf_Sym *Symbol, StringRef StrTable,
248 StringRef StrTable, SymtabName; in printSymbolsHelper() local
252 StrTable = DynamicStringTable; in printSymbolsHelper()
260 StrTable = unwrapOrError(Obj->getStringTableForSymtab(*DotSymtabSec)); in printSymbolsHelper()
269 ELFDumperStyle->printSymbol(Obj, &Sym, Syms.begin(), StrTable, IsDynamic); in printSymbolsHelper()
291 const Elf_Sym *FirstSym, StringRef StrTable,
344 StringRef StrTable, bool IsDynamic) override;
375 StringRef StrTable, bool IsDynamic) override;
509 StringRef StrTable = Dumper->getDynamicStringTable(); in printVersionSymbolSection() local
516 Dumper->getFullSymbolName(&Sym, StrTable, true /* IsDynamic */); in printVersionSymbolSection()
[all …]
DARMEHABIPrinter.h354 StringRef StrTable = *StrTableOrErr; in FunctionAtAddress() local
359 auto NameOrErr = Sym.getName(StrTable); in FunctionAtAddress()
/external/llvm/tools/obj2yaml/
Delf2yaml.cpp32 StringRef StrTable, ELFYAML::Symbol &S);
143 StringRef StrTable = *StrTableOrErr; in dump() local
154 ELFDumper<ELFT>::dumpSymbol(&Sym, Symtab, StrTable, S)) in dump()
179 StringRef StrTable, ELFYAML::Symbol &S) { in dumpSymbol() argument
185 Expected<StringRef> SymbolNameOrErr = Sym->getName(StrTable); in dumpSymbol()
/external/llvm-project/llvm/tools/obj2yaml/
Delf2yaml.cpp50 StringRef StrTable,
68 StringRef StrTable, ELFYAML::Symbol &S);
154 ELFDumper<ELFT>::getUniquedSymbolName(const Elf_Sym *Sym, StringRef StrTable, in getUniquedSymbolName() argument
156 Expected<StringRef> SymbolNameOrErr = Sym->getName(StrTable); in getUniquedSymbolName()
639 StringRef StrTable = *StrTableOrErr; in dumpSymbols() local
652 if (auto EC = dumpSymbol(&Sym, Symtab, StrTable, S)) in dumpSymbols()
662 StringRef StrTable, ELFYAML::Symbol &S) { in dumpSymbol() argument
670 getUniquedSymbolName(Sym, StrTable, SymTab); in dumpSymbol()
/external/llvm-project/llvm/tools/llvm-readobj/
DELFDumper.cpp398 Optional<StringRef> StrTable,
706 Optional<StringRef> StrTable; in printSymbolsHelper() local
712 StrTable = DynamicStringTable; in printSymbolsHelper()
718 StrTable = *StrTableOrErr; in printSymbolsHelper()
743 ELFDumperStyle->printSymbol(Sym, &Sym - Syms.begin(), StrTable, IsDynamic, in printSymbolsHelper()
774 Optional<StringRef> StrTable, bool IsDynamic,
935 StringRef StrTable, uint32_t Bucket);
943 Optional<StringRef> StrTable, bool IsDynamic,
1008 Optional<StringRef> StrTable, bool IsDynamic,
1195 Optional<StringRef> StrTable, in getFullSymbolName() argument
[all …]
DARMEHABIPrinter.h374 StringRef StrTable = *StrTableOrErr; in FunctionAtAddress() local
381 auto NameOrErr = Sym.getName(StrTable); in FunctionAtAddress()